Discuss the role and responsibilities of prosecutors in criminal cases, including their duty to seek justice and protect the rights of the accused.



Prosecutors play a vital role in the criminal justice system, representing the interests of the state or government in criminal cases. They have specific roles and responsibilities, including their duty to seek justice and protect the rights of the accused. Let's explore the role and responsibilities of prosecutors in criminal cases: 1. Seeking Justice: The primary duty of a prosecutor is to seek justice. This means that prosecutors are not simply advocates for conviction, but rather their ultimate goal is to ensure a fair and just outcome. They have a responsibility to consider the evidence and make informed decisions based on the principles of fairness, truth, and the best interests of society. 2. Charging Decisions: Prosecutors have the authority to make charging decisions, which involve determining whether there is sufficient evidence to proceed with a criminal case. They review the evidence, interview witnesses, consult with law enforcement agencies, and evaluate the strength of the case. Prosecutors must exercise discretion and make charging decisions that are grounded in the law and supported by the available evidence. 3.
